The Complete Overview of How Long Seroquel Takes to Work
Seroquel, or quetiapine, is a second-generation antipsychotic with a dual role: it’s prescribed for both psychiatric conditions (schizophrenia, bipolar disorder) and off-label for insomnia. Its versatility stems from its ability to modulate multiple neurotransmitter systems, but this same complexity explains why **how long Seroquel takes to work** isn’t a fixed number. The drug’s effects are dose-dependent, condition-specific, and influenced by individual metabolism. For example, a 25mg dose for sleep may show sedative effects within hours, while a 400mg dose for bipolar mania might require weeks to stabilize mood. The timeline also hinges on the drug’s pharmacokinetics. Seroquel is metabolized by the liver, with a half-life of roughly **7 hours**, meaning it takes about 24–48 hours for the body to eliminate half the dose. However, its active metabolites extend its influence, contributing to a more prolonged therapeutic window. This is why some patients feel initial sedation quickly but notice delayed antipsychotic benefits—like reduced paranoia or improved cognitive clarity—as the drug accumulates in the system. Quetiapine was first approved by the FDA in 1997 for schizophrenia and later for bipolar disorder, marking a shift from older antipsychotics like haloperidol, which primarily targeted dopamine. Seroquel’s development reflected a growing understanding that mental health conditions required a more nuanced approach—one that addressed both positive symptoms (hallucinations, delusions) and negative symptoms (apathy, cognitive dulling). Its off-label use for insomnia emerged as clinicians observed its sedative effects at lower doses, a serendipitous discovery that expanded its clinical utility. Seroquel’s primary mechanism involves **antagonism of dopamine D2 and serotonin 5-HT2A receptors**, but its effects extend to other neurotransmitter systems, including histamine (H1) and adrenergic receptors. This polypharmacology explains why it works for both psychiatric and sleep-related conditions. For insomnia, the blockade of histamine receptors induces sedation, while for bipolar disorder, the dopamine and serotonin modulation helps stabilize mood swings. Q: Can Seroquel work within the first 24 hours?
A: Yes, but only for its sedative effects. At low doses (e.g., 25–50mg), many patients experience drowsiness within **30 minutes to 2 hours**, making it useful for insomnia. However, antipsychotic or mood-stabilizing effects typically require **at least 1–2 weeks** of consistent use to develop.
Q: Why does it take weeks for Seroquel to work for bipolar disorder?
A: Bipolar disorder involves complex neurotransmitter imbalances, particularly in dopamine and serotonin pathways. Seroquel’s receptors need time to reset and achieve a new equilibrium. Additionally, the drug’s metabolites (breakdown products) contribute to delayed but cumulative effects, which is why full benefits often take **4–8 weeks**.
Q: Will taking a higher dose make Seroquel work faster?
A: Not necessarily. While higher doses (e.g., 400mg+) may accelerate antipsychotic effects for some, rapid dose escalation increases side effects like dizziness, sedation, or metabolic changes. Clinicians usually titrate slowly (e.g., increasing by 25–100mg every 3–7 days) to balance efficacy and tolerability.

Q: Can Seroquel be stopped abruptly if it’s not working?
A: No. Abrupt discontinuation can cause withdrawal symptoms like nausea, insomnia, or even rebound psychosis. If Seroquel isn’t effective, the dose should be tapered over **1–2 weeks** under medical supervision. Never stop without consulting your doctor.

Q: How do I know if Seroquel is working for my specific condition?
A: Track symptoms using a **mood/sleep diary** or validated scales (e.g., PHQ-9 for depression, YMRS for mania). For insomnia, note: - Time to fall asleep. - Nighttime awakenings. - Morning alertness. For psychiatric conditions, observe changes in: - Hallucinations/delusions (if present). - Energy levels (mania) or fatigue (depression). - Cognitive clarity (e.g., focus, memory). Share these observations with your clinician to assess progress.
